A bullet of mass m moving with velocity `upsilon_(1)` strikes a suspended wooden block of mass M as shown in the figure and sticks to it. If the block rises to a height y. the initial of the bullet is

Text Solution

Verified by Experts

Initial kinetic energy of the block when the bullet strikes.
`=(1)/(2)(m+M)v^(2)`
Due to this kinetic energy, the block will block will rise to a height h. Its potential energy =(m+M) gh
So, from the law of conservation of energy
`(1)/(2)(M+m)v^(2)=(M+m) gh implies v=sqrt(2gh)`
